Wits is one of six Attributes in Divinity: Original Sin II. During character creation, all Attributes have a base value of 10.

Effects

Each point of Wits increases Critical Chance by 1% and Initiative by 1, resulting in initial values for Critical Chance at 0% and Initiative at 10. Additionally, higher Wits increases the likelihood of detecting traps and hidden treasures.
